What Types of Work and Facilities Can Radiologic Technologists Expect in Portsmouth, VA?

As a Certified Radiology Technologist working in Portsmouth, Virginia, you can expect to find a diverse range of opportunities across various healthcare facilities, including hospitals, outpatient clinics, and specialty imaging centers. In Portsmouth, renowned institutions like Bon Secours Maryview Medical Center and the Naval Medical Center Portsmouth offer a dynamic work environment where you’ll perform essential diagnostic imaging procedures such as X-rays, MRIs, and CT scans. These positions not only involve operating advanced imaging equipment but also require meticulous patient care, ensuring comfort and safety throughout the procedure. Additionally, you may have the chance to coll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to enhance patient outcomes, participate in community health initiatives, and engage in continuing education programs to advance your skills and career in this vital healthcare field.

This Radiology Technologist opportunity is based in Westfield, New York, a picturesque community along the shores of Lake Erie. Westfield offers the charm of a small town with the added benefit of stunning lake views, rolling vineyards, and a welcoming, close-knit atmosphere. Known as part of New York’s “Grape Country,” the area features local wineries, farm stands, and scenic drives that make it an appealing place to both live and work. The location provides an ideal balance of peaceful, lakeside living and access to amenities. Residents enjoy nearby Lake Erie beaches, Barcelona Harbor, fishing, boating, hiking, and year-round outdoor recreation. Seasonal festivals, local arts events, and farmers markets contribute to a vibrant local culture. Westfield’s position in Western New York also offers easy access to regional hubs like Erie, Pennsylvania and Buffalo, New York, for additional dining, entertainment, sporting events, and travel connections. The facility itself offers a community-focused care environment with modern diagnostic imaging equipment and a strong emphasis on quality, safety, and patient-centered service. Radiology Technologists here are valued members of the care team and are supported by collaborative relationships with radiologists, nurses, and other allied health professionals. The practice environment is designed to support technologists in delivering high-quality images and compassionate care to patients across the lifespan. In this role, you can expect to perform a wide range of general diagnostic radiographic examinations, including routine outpatient imaging, inpatient imaging, emergency department studies, and portable exams as needed. Typical procedures may include chest radiographs, skeletal studies, spine imaging, abdomen imaging, and fluoroscopic support for procedures based on physician orders and facility capabilities. Technologists are responsible for accurate patient positioning, technique selection, image acquisition, and ensuring image quality that meets diagnostic standards. Your typical day may involve checking imaging orders for appropriateness, verifying patient identity and consent, explaining procedures to patients, performing radiographic exams, ensuring radiation safety for patients and staff, and working closely with providers to prioritize urgent or emergent cases. You will use digital imaging systems and PACS for image processing and transmission, and you may assist in coordinating workflow with the radiology reading room and other departments. The work environment supports independent practice within established protocols, while still offering guidance from experienced colleagues and medical staff. Depending on the department structure, shifts may include days, evenings, nights, and weekend or holiday rotations. Patient volumes and acuity can vary, with a mix of scheduled outpatient exams and unscheduled inpatient or emergency studies. In a community setting, technologists often enjoy the opportunity to build rapport with patients and families, providing continuity of care and contributing meaningfully to the overall patient experience. This position is particularly well-suited for Radiology Technologists who appreciate working in a supportive, team-based environment where their skills are recognized and utilized across multiple patient care areas. The role provides the opportunity to strengthen general radiography skills, gain experience with diverse patient populations, and contribute to care in a setting where your work has a visible impact on the community.

What types of experience are required or preferred for a Rad Tech Travel job in Portsmouth?

Radiology Tech travel jobs in Portsmouth, Virginia typically require candidates to have a valid ARRT certification and state licensure, along with relevant clinical experience in radiographic procedures. Preference is often given to those with prior travel experience or proficiency in specialized imaging modalities such as CT or MRI.
